Description

Three Bedroom Victorian Home Arranged Across Four Floors

Some homes simply offer more than you expect, and this is one of them. Arranged across four floors, this attractive period home delivers flexible living space, plenty of character and a layout that adapts beautifully to modern family life. With woodland opposite, a long rear garden and excellent village amenities within walking distance, it offers an appealing lifestyle as well as a great place to call home.

About The Home

Step inside and you'll immediately appreciate that this is not your typical terrace. The accommodation has been thoughtfully arranged over four floors, creating distinct spaces that work equally well for everyday family life and entertaining.

The ground floor is centred around a generous kitchen diner, offering plenty of room for cooking, dining and gathering with friends and family. Modern units provide excellent storage and workspace, while direct access to the garden makes outdoor dining during the warmer months wonderfully convenient.

The separate living room provides a cosy and welcoming space to relax at the end of the day.

Moving up to the first floor, you'll find another spacious reception room currently used as the main lounge. Having two reception rooms gives the home excellent flexibility, allowing buyers to tailor the accommodation to suit their own lifestyle. Alongside this is a separate snug or reading room, equally suited as a home office, playroom or quiet retreat.

The second floor offers two comfortable bedrooms together with the family bathroom, while the top floor is dedicated entirely to the impressive principal bedroom. Full of character, this loft-style room enjoys a wonderful sense of space, complemented by useful eaves storage on both sides.

Outside, the rear garden has been landscaped into several distinct areas, creating spaces to sit, entertain and enjoy throughout the seasons. A paved terrace leads onto raised planting beds and lawn, while the south west facing aspect allows the garden to enjoy sunshine well into the afternoon and evening. Looking beyond the garden towards mature trees creates a particularly attractive backdrop that adds to the feeling of privacy.

Parking

Whilst most terraced homes have street parking, this home benefits a place to park at the rear behind the garden. Just outside the garden gate, is a space for you to park your vehicle, sitting comfortably on paved slab stone.

Location and Lifestyle

Woodford Halse is a well served village with a strong sense of community, and Sidney Road places you within easy reach of everything you need for day to day life.

Just a short walk away, Station Road offers a great selection of local amenities including a Post Office, pharmacy, butcher, Co Op, library café, takeaways, restaurant, barber and hairdresser. The village also benefits from a primary school, regular bus services, a football club and a popular annual summer festival that brings the community together.

One of the standout features of this home is its position. With woodland directly opposite, it enjoys a more open outlook than many neighbouring terraces, while the south west facing rear garden looks towards mature trees, creating an attractive setting and making it an ideal place to enjoy the afternoon and evening sun.
